Genghis has typically had readings 250+ for her AMPS

Yesterday, I started a sliding scale of Caninsulin and she had 1.25u after AMPS of 380, and 1.0u with a PMPS of 340. Her food schedule has remained the same.

This morning she shot me a 196, within 20 minutes of eating ⅔ of her canned meal she is now at 247.

Do I give her a token dose, or skip, based on her original pre-shot <200?

Her nadir lately has never been below 77. I will be home most of the day to monitor.

Thoughts?
 
I think that'd be fine. 196 is practically 200. Maybe shoot a little less than you did last night. If you can monitor, it should be good.

The goal is to get them into a regulated range (Mid 200 preshot and double digits at nadir, but not below 50) and under the renal threshold (around 250) the majority of the time so their pancreas can heal.
